Abstract
We developed a selective antibody to a synthetic peptide corresponding to a n N-terminal sequence of the PCTAIRE-1 protein. In rodent brain extracts it recognized only the protein doublet characteristic of PCTAIRE-1, and this signal is completely abolished by preincubation of the antibody with the im munopeptide. Immunolabeling experiments done with this PCTAIRE-1-specific a ntibody reveal that the protein is widely distributed in the rodent brain a s are the mRNAs visualized using an antisense riboprobe corresponding to th e entire PCTAIRE-1 open reading frame. Two types of PCTAIRE-1 protein local izations were observed: first a diffuse labeling of almost all brain region s, particularly intense in the molecular layer of the cerebellum and the mo ssy fiber region of the hippocampus, and second a spot-like localization in the nuclei of large neurons such as cerebellar Purkinje cells and pyramida l cells of the hippocampus. Colocalization with the B23 protein allows one to identify these compartments as nucleoli. Our results suggest a nucleolar function of PCTAIRE-1 in large neurons and a role in regions containing im portant granule cell projections.
